WebbArrhythmias are abnormal heartbeats usually caused by an electrical "short circuit" in the heart. The heart normally beats in a consistent pattern, but an arrhythmia can make it beat too slowly, too quickly, or irregularly. This can cause the heart to pump inconsistently, leading to symptoms like fatigue, dizziness, and chest pain. WebbWhen you are dehydrated, your cardiac output decreases significantly. Even though heart rate is increased, the amount of blood that the heart can pump per beat is reduced because of overall low blood volume. For example, during dehydration your heart rate might be 90 beats a minute, but your heart might be pumping only 40 milliliters per beat ...

Webb19 okt. 2024 · A low heart rate may be a sign of an efficiently working heart. Or, if the rate becomes too low, it could be a sign of health complications down the road. A normal or healthy resting heart rate for an adult is between 60 and 100 beats a minute. A heart rate near the lower end of that range is considered a good sign. WebbIf you have heart failure, your heart can’t pump blood as well as it should. Over time, this leads to fluid buildup (congestion) in different parts of your body, including your legs, feet and lungs. You may also feel other symptoms including shortness of breath and fatigue. Heart failure is progressive, meaning it gets worse over time. WebbCongestive heart failure symptoms include: Shortness of breath. Waking up short of breath at night. Chest pain. Heart palpitations. Fatigue when you’re active. Swelling in your ankles, legs and abdomen. Weight gain. …

The heart has an intrinsic chaotic behavior ... WebbA human heart weighs a little more than a half-pound. A horse’s heart is more than ten times heavier than a human’s. A horse’s heart pumps about 35 – 40 liters of blood per minute. However, during intense galloping (when the heart rate is higher than 220 bpm), the heart may pump up to 250 liters per minute.

It is also used when there is a Myocardial … data security measures in healthcareWebbHeart failure means that the heart is unable to pump blood around the body properly. It usually happens because the heart has become too weak or stiff. It's sometimes called congestive heart failure, although this name is not widely used now. Heart failure does not mean your heart has stopped working. bits troubleshooting tool
